State senate won't wait for judge to rule in audit dispute, passes subpoena bill

Next week a superior court judge is scheduled to hear arguments to determine if the Maricopa County Board of Supervisors must comply with subpoenas issued by the State Senate ordering it to turn over sensitive election data for an audit.

Thursday, Republicans in the State Senate decided they were not going to wait for a ruling.
